QUOTE(Asus @ Oct 25 2018, 04:15 PM)
hi guys, i noticed that the hose from power steering pump is leaking..how much to fix the hose? i got quote from workshop nearby my hse around rm200..but dunno the details whether they change together the power steering oil or not..
*
This is my breakdown for replacing the power steering hose last year

- Replace power steering hose RM25
- Upper power steering hose RM20
- Lower hose clip RM3 x 2
- Upper hose clip RM2.50 x 2
- Power steering fluid RM30.91
- Labour to replace power steering hose RM40

Total - RM126 (maybe ranges from RM125 - RM160)

QUOTE(inferno_17_85 @ Mar 9 2019, 03:21 PM)
If no leak in few days time, i recommend send to flush, and fill it with 50% coolant + 50% distilled water (can use battery water or air suling in supermarket), or those premixed coolant. Most mechanic use tap water because they worried if there's leak then your coolant wasted already.

Using pure coolant will reduce the boiling point of your radiator content to that of alcohol, means that your water pump will work harder to remove specified heat from engine, compared to those 50/50 coolant-water mix. Something like that.

On the side note actually pure water works well for Malaysian weather also. But we need the rust inhibition function of coolant.

QUOTE(potatocam @ May 17 2023, 06:57 PM)
Hi all, just now on the way back from work, i noticed my car temp go up until almost to the max during idle/stuck at traffic jam and traffic light.
But when the car moves, it dropped back to the normal level (centre) almost immediately.
Then when the car stopped again at traffic light, the meter goes up slowly and drop down again when moving.

Stopped the car, open bonnet, see no leak whatsoever, no smoke/burn smell, the fan was spinning.
Last CNY, already changed to new water pump + timing belt set, which also change the coolant.

Was the problem related to termostat or others?  hmm.gif Also the car is 15 years old.
*
I also faced the same problem like this before, then I ask my mechanic to really check all the piping and it seem that it has some cracked on it and also check the fins on the radiator. Change both with new parts and fill only coolant, now it is working as usual without over heating issue.
